Remote water temperature measuring device for aquaculture

By designing a long-distance thermometer for aquaculture water temperature, and using a motor drive and a wave plate to achieve the oscillation of the thermometer, the problem of limited temperature measurement range in existing technologies is solved, the flexibility and practicality of the thermometer are improved, and its service life is extended.

Abstract

The utility model relates to the technical field of aquaculture, and discloses a water temperature long-distance temperature measuring device for aquaculture, which comprises a mounting plate arranged on the side wall of a pond main body, a vertical groove is formed in the surface of the mounting plate, a fixing rod is fixedly connected in the vertical groove, a sliding sleeve is slidably sleeved on the surface of the fixing rod, and the sliding sleeve is fixedly connected with the vertical groove. A temperature measuring assembly is arranged on the surface of the sliding sleeve and comprises a [-shaped block, a connecting rod is fixedly connected to the surface of the [-shaped block, a temperature measuring device can be driven by starting a motor to measure the temperature of different depths, and then the vertical temperature gradient of the water body is known; and subsequently, the temperature detector swings under the cooperation of the waved plate and the connecting assembly, and the temperature monitoring of different areas is realized, so that the temperature measurement coverage range is increased, and the flexibility and practicability of the temperature detector are greatly improved.

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of aquaculture technology, specifically to a long-distance thermometer for aquaculture water temperature measurement. Background Technology

[0002] Aquaculture is a production activity involving the breeding, cultivation, and harvesting of aquatic plants and animals under human control. High-density intensive farming uses methods such as flowing water, temperature control, oxygenation, and feeding high-quality feed to achieve high yields by raising fish and shrimp at high density in small bodies of water. Examples include high-density fish and shrimp farming in flowing water.

[0003] In aquaculture, monitoring water temperature is crucial because it significantly impacts the growth, reproduction, and health of aquatic animals. However, existing aquaculture thermometers have limited measurement range. Real-time monitoring of the entire aquaculture environment's temperature distribution requires automated robots or underwater drones equipped with temperature sensors to move within the aquaculture area and collect temperature data. While this method provides more comprehensive temperature distribution information, it is also more costly and complex. Alternatively, multiple temperature monitoring points can be set up, increasing the number of thermometers required and further raising costs, thus reducing practicality. Therefore, we propose a long-range aquaculture water temperature thermometer to address these issues. Utility Model Content

[0041] Working principle:

[0042] When using this long-distance temperature measuring device for aquaculture, to measure the temperature inside the main body 1 of the pond, the motor 10 is started. The rotation of the output shaft of the motor 10 drives the first rotating rod 9 to rotate, which in turn drives the reciprocating screw 8 to rotate. At this time, since the connecting block 13 is slidably connected inside the through groove 12 and is fixedly connected to the reciprocating screw sleeve 11, the rotation of the reciprocating screw 8 drives the reciprocating screw sleeve 11 to move. The movement of 13 can cause the sliding sleeve 5 to slide on the surface of the fixed rod 4, and the sliding sleeve 5 will not rotate under the restriction of the connecting block 13. Subsequently, the movement of the sliding sleeve 5 can drive the movement of the connecting rod 602 in the temperature measuring component 6, the movement of the connecting rod 602 can drive the movement of the C-shaped block 601, the movement of the C-shaped block 601 can drive the movement of the swing block 603, and the movement of the swing block 603 can drive the movement of the thermometer body 604, ultimately realizing the temperature measurement work at different depths inside the pond body 1.

[0043] When the thermometer body 604 moves vertically, the swing block 603 drives the fixed block 1501 in the connecting assembly 15 to move. The movement of the fixed block 1501 drives the movement of the connecting plate 1502, which in turn drives the movement of the sliding wheel 1504 located in the groove 1503. At this time, the sliding wheel 1504 moves on the surface of the corrugated plate 14. When the connecting assembly 15 moves to the recess of the corrugated plate 14, the thermometer body 604 will swing to the left. Subsequently, as the connecting assembly 15 moves towards the protrusion of the corrugated plate 14... The thermometer body 604 will gradually swing to the right. At this time, the torsion spring 18 will deform, and the connecting plate 1502 will rotate between the two fixed blocks 1501. The swing block 603 will rotate between the two horizontal plates of the U-shaped block 601. When the connecting component 15 moves from the protrusion to the recess, the thermometer body 604 can be reset by the elastic force of the torsion spring 18 itself. In this way, the thermometer body 604 can swing horizontally during the vertical reciprocating motion by the elastic force of the torsion spring 18 itself, thereby increasing the temperature measurement coverage and improving the representativeness of the data.

[0044] When the temperature measuring component 6 swings horizontally, since the length of the pull rod 1903 is fixed and the cleaning ring 1901 is slidably sleeved on the outside of the temperature measuring body 604, the cleaning ring 1901 will slide on the surface of the temperature measuring body 604 under the restriction of the two vertical rods 1902 and the pull rod 1903 when the temperature measuring body 604 swings, thus achieving the scraping of algae on the surface of the temperature measuring body 604 and improving the service life of the temperature measuring body 604.
